Output 742ba7b512d16fa9148e8bb4ba93984aa175fc58f031c41731ba2485f5a8bc66:5

value
84077720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d3cb63dead0b20da2f9ca745bf4c2ae0eb87a8c OP_EQUAL
address
3AC1VighuDPznwuMgf7qxUKC8biAMyyEZd
transaction
742ba7b512d16fa9148e8bb4ba93984aa175fc58f031c41731ba2485f5a8bc66
spent
true